Output c95959a85ea48fec1f5f23c7ee38b5bafc53c65fb66ce6987a6834319dd92012:17

value
9826865135
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39bdf8eb07293982b9bca4751c134eee24ecb031 OP_EQUAL
address
2MxWY5j9wMNDhQNz4ouodRTZmwmYWZfYUx6
transaction
c95959a85ea48fec1f5f23c7ee38b5bafc53c65fb66ce6987a6834319dd92012